Windows 11: Welcome to the Next Evolution
Windows 11 is Microsoft’s most modern operating system release, offering a dynamic and user-first design. It installs a middle-based Start Menu with a minimalist taskbar layout, and curved edges to give a seamless and sleek touch. The platform runs leaner and faster than before. Reducing lag during heavy multitasking sessions.
-
New Widgets Feature
The new Widgets feature in Windows 11 provides personalized content like news, weather updates, and calendar events right at your fingertips.
-
Focus Assist
Windows 11 introduces Focus Assist to help you concentrate by temporarily silencing notifications when you’re working on important tasks.
-
Modernized Windows Settings
The Settings app in Windows 11 has been completely revamped, offering a clearer, more streamlined layout for better user experience.
-
Support for New Input Devices
Windows 11 supports the latest input devices, including touchscreens, pens, and gesture controls, making interactions more fluid.
Windows Defender: Native Protection for Windows OS
Windows Defender, also dubbed Microsoft Defender AV works as Microsoft’s holistic antivirus and security tool, is seamlessly included in Windows 10 and Windows 11 environments. It strengthens your computer’s resistance to malware. Helping block malware, spyware, rootkits, viruses, and more.
The Start Menu in the current public release of Windows
It has undergone key transformations, providing a more focused and approachable experience. The Start Menu now emphasizes central positioning and usability, optimizing ease-of-use with a minimalist layout. It combines app pins with a minimal search box, and streamlined access to user preferences, power, and configurations.
Virtual Desktop Support: A Smarter Way to Manage Your Digital Workspace
Virtual Desktop Support is included automatically in Windows 10 and Windows 11. It simplifies navigation between different tasks by using virtual desktops for organization. Virtual Desktop Support ensures efficient management of multiple desktops with simple tools. It is available in all configurations of Windows 10 and Windows 11, from personal to enterprise versions.
Microsoft Store: Offering a Wide Selection of Apps and Entertainment for Windows
The Microsoft Store is available as part of the default Windows 10 and 11 installations, It’s a comprehensive store for games, apps, music, and movies, The Microsoft Store is a default feature in both Windows 10 and Windows 11 setups, It offers simple tools for keeping apps updated and removing outdated ones, It allows you to buy, rent, and stream a wide variety of entertainment content,
- Light Windows version for low-spec PCs
- Windows with no background assistant services active
- ISO prepared for performance testing
- Windows version with update feature disabled